What is a Small Pram?
A small pram, frequently referred to as a compact stroller, is designed to be lightweight and easy to steer in tight areas. These prams usually have a smaller footprint compared to conventional strollers, making them perfect for city dwellers and parents who often browse congested locations or public transportation.

Small prams come with numerous advantages particularly for newborns and their parents, including:

Enhanced Maneuverability: Urban environments typically present narrow pathways and crowded areas. A small pram is much easier to browse and kip down tight spots.

Convenience: Lightweight designs and quick folding capabilities imply moms and dads can quickly load prams into lorries or bring them onto public transport without breaking a sweat.

Convenience: Many compact prams boast quality cushioning and adjustable recline alternatives, making sure that newborns remain comfortable throughout getaways.

Price: Smaller prams are typically more budget-friendly than larger designs, making them accessible for parents looking for useful however economical solutions.

Versatility: Many small prams are created to accommodate newborns approximately toddlers, offering long-lasting usage as the child grows.
